Stripping a MX bike is a piece of piss really. There's not much on them.
Plastics, tank, seat off.
Leave the rear wheel/shock/linkage attached to the swinger, just remove the top shock bolt, swinger pivot and linkage bolt.
Leave the front end in one piece, just undo the top clamp, stem nut and slide the whole lot out.
Rads, pipe, electrics off, then the engines out.
If your getting the frame powder coated, you might need to re-tap the threads in the frame or put old bolts in the threads.
While everything is apart, it's a great opportunity to grease/replace the linkage/shock/headset and wheel bearings.
